Time and Tide Caryl Beach - Cathy Smale Digswell Fellows, Caryl Beach and Cathy Smale have been brought together in this collaboration through their love of seascapes and a fascination of the beach pebbles found on our shores worn away over millions of years, each unique from …

Digswell Arts 60th Anniversary
The Digswell Arts Trust was founded in 1957 by Henry Morris, the revolutionary educationalist, and inaugurated by Lady Mountbatten on 29th May 1959. Morris was a great enthusiast for the arts, and had been appointed to the Ministry of Town and Country Planning to advise on the cultural and leisure arrangements in the recently designated …
